WebPeriods of high water demand during which soil moisture was also abundant ( i.e., late spring and early summer) were related to increased shallow root production. Root length mortality was low at these times, but the correlation with soil moisture was statistically significant only in the shallow depth increment. WebMar 3, 2024 · The mixture effects on fine root length revealed a positive relationship with forest net primary productivity. Root length production, which is the growth of new roots within a year, was not affected by tree species mixtures except for the 8-year-old stand in 2015.
